#8d0603 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8d0603 is composed of 55.3% red, 2.4%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.7% magenta, 97.9%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 1.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 28.2%. #8d0603 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0c06 with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

● #8d0603 color description : Dark red.
#8d0603 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8d0603 has RGB values of R:141, G:6,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.98,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9242115.
